The radiosonde market has witnessed significant growth in recent years due to its vital role in atmospheric research and meteorological forecasting. Radiosondes are integral instruments used for measuring various atmospheric parameters like temperature, humidity, pressure, and wind speed at various altitudes. This market is primarily driven by advancements in sensor technology, the increasing need for precise weather forecasting, and the expansion of meteorological studies across diverse sectors. 1. Meteorological Application
In the meteorological sector, radiosondes are pivotal in collecting atmospheric data that helps meteorologists understand weather patterns and predict future weather conditions. These devices are launched into the atmosphere, typically attached to weather balloons, and transmit real-time data to ground-based stations. The data gathered by radiosondes, including temperature, humidity, pressure, and wind speed, are crucial for weather forecasting, climate research, and storm tracking. With the increasing demand for accurate weather predictions, radiosondes have become essential for improving the accuracy of forecasting models used by government agencies and private weather services.
In addition to routine weather forecasting, radiosondes also play a critical role in extreme weather monitoring, such as hurricanes, tornadoes, and cyclones. By providing detailed atmospheric profiles at various altitudes, these devices assist meteorologists in tracking the development and movement of these storms, helping to issue early warnings and prepare affected regions. As the frequency and intensity of extreme weather events increase due to climate change, the reliance on radiosondes in meteorological applications is expected to grow, thus driving market expansion.
2. Research Application
Radiosondes are widely used in scientific research, particularly in atmospheric studies, climate change research, and environmental monitoring. In this context, they provide valuable data on atmospheric conditions at different altitudes, offering insight into processes such as cloud formation, heat transfer, and moisture distribution. The data collected from radiosondes enables researchers to build more accurate models of weather patterns, the behavior of the atmosphere, and even space weather phenomena. This application has grown significantly with the increased focus on understanding global climate change and its impacts on various ecosystems.
In addition to climate research, radiosondes also support research in other domains, such as aviation safety, oceanography, and even space exploration. By providing atmospheric profiles that are crucial for flight path optimization and predicting turbulence, radiosondes enhance the safety of air travel. Furthermore, these instruments are used in oceanography to study weather systems over large bodies of water. The versatility of radiosondes in different research fields drives their demand, particularly in academic and government research institutions focused on enhancing scientific knowledge and tackling global challenges.
3. Military Application
The military application of radiosondes is focused on gathering vital atmospheric data to support operations that rely on precise weather conditions, such as missile guidance, artillery targeting, and aircraft navigation. In military operations, accurate weather data is crucial for ensuring mission success and minimizing risks. Radiosondes are used to measure wind patterns, air pressure, temperature, and humidity at various altitudes, which significantly impact the effectiveness of military strategies. This data aids in adjusting operational tactics and planning military exercises or missions that depend on specific weather conditions, such as airstrikes or troop movements in extreme climates.
In addition to tactical applications, radiosondes are also essential in military research and development. The data gathered by these instruments helps in the design and testing of new military equipment, such as unmanned aerial vehicles (UAVs) and advanced surveillance systems. Radiosondes are also used in assessing the impact of weather on warfare, providing a comprehensive understanding of how atmospheric conditions affect military performance. With an increasing focus on enhancing military capabilities and operational readiness, the demand for radiosondes in the defense sector is expected to remain robust and continue growing in the coming years.

What is a radiosonde and what does it measure?
A radiosonde is an instrument used to measure atmospheric parameters such as temperature, humidity, and pressure at various altitudes, typically during weather balloon launches.
Why are radiosondes important in weather forecasting?
Radiosondes provide real-time data on atmospheric conditions, which is crucial for accurate weather prediction and modeling by meteorologists.
How do radiosondes transmit data?
Radiosondes transmit collected atmospheric data to ground stations via radio signals during their ascent in the atmosphere.
What are the applications of radiosondes in meteorology?
In meteorology, radiosondes are used for weather forecasting, extreme weather monitoring, and climate research by collecting data on temperature, humidity, and pressure.
Can radiosondes be used in research other than weather forecasting?
Yes, radiosondes are used in climate research, space exploration, oceanography, and aviation safety, among other fields.
What role do radiosondes play in military applications?
Radiosondes provide crucial atmospheric data for military operations, including missile guidance, artillery targeting, and aircraft navigation.
How long do radiosondes remain in the atmosphere?
Radiosondes typically remain in the atmosphere for about 1 to 2 hours before the weather balloon bursts, and the device returns to the ground via parachute.
Are there any environmental concerns associated with radiosonde use?
There are environmental concerns regarding the disposal of the weather balloons and radiosondes, though many manufacturers are working on more eco-friendly materials.
What advancements are being made in radiosonde technology?
Recent advancements in radiosonde technology include enhanced sensors, wireless communication systems, and integration with unmanned aerial vehicles (UAVs) for more efficient data collection.
